i’m honestly not sure how to feel about this one, which is disappointing because i loved the first book so much. i went into this expecting the same emotional depth and chemistry, but this one just fell really flat for me. unfortunately, there’s barely any actual plot. most of the book is just hunter and maggie exchanging heated looks over and over again with very little meaningful dialogue or genuine interaction. because of that, i never really believed in their relationship beyond the physical attraction. it didn’t feel like they truly knew each other or even liked each other on a deeper level. it also felt like nothing really happened for most of the story. the pacing dragged, but somehow the ending still felt rushed and underdeveloped at the same time. once things finally started happening, everything wrapped up way too quickly and awkwardly. and the main reason hunter and maggie supposedly couldn’t be together just felt so trivial that it was hard for me to stay invested in all the tension and drama surrounding them. overall, i wanted so much more from this after loving the first book, but this one just didn’t work for me emotionally or plot-wise.
